Which would you expect to have a higher boiling point: HCl or H2O? EXPLAIN.
H2O has hydrogen bonding.
HCl has dipole dipole.
H2O is more attracted; harder to separate; higher boiling point.

Which two shapes are always polar AND what makes them always polar?
Bent & pyramidal
Lone pairs on the central atom
Which would you expect to have a higher vapor pressure: HBr or NH3?
NH3 has hydrogen bonding; HBr has dipole dipole.
NH3 is more attracted; harder to separate; less likely to lose molecules to the gas phase.
HBr has higher vapor pressure.
